(IN-NURS-IUINA) Department Information The Indiana University (IU) School of Nursing is annually ranked among the top nursing schools in the nation. Founded in 1914, the school offers programs from the Bachelor of Science in Nursing (BSN) through the doctorate and is composed of campuses in Bloomington, Fort Wayne, and Indianapolis. IU School of Nursing rose to number 13 in the nation for undergraduate nursing programs in the 2026 Unites States News and World Report rankings, up 26 spots from the previous year. Job Summary Provides administrative support to executives, exercising confidentiality, tact, and diplomacy. Utilizes business software applications to prepare correspondence, reports, presentations, agendas, minutes, etc. Receives, screens, and directs incoming calls, visitors, mail, and email promptly, courteously, and accurately. Manages executive's calendar, meetings, travel, correspondence, and budget. Acts as informal resource for colleagues with less experience; responds to more complex or escalated inquiries. Identifies, enhances, and follows specific processes and procedures to maximize the efficiencies of the business to which the support is being provided. May perform other duties related to maintaining an internal website and/or working with social media. Qualifications Combinations of related education and experience may be considered. Education beyond the minimum required may be substituted for work experience. Work experience beyond the minimum required may be substituted for education.
EDUCATION
Required High school diploma or equivalent (such as HSED or GED).
WORK EXPERIENCE
Required 4 years of relevant experience. SKILLS Required Excellent organizational skills. Demonstrates ability to maintain confidential information. Strong verbal communication and listening skills. Excellent collaboration and team building skills. Demonstrates excellent judgment and decision making skills. Effective conflict management skills. Working Conditions / Demands This role requires the ability to effectively communicate and to operate a computer and other standard office productivity equipment. The position involves sedentary work as well as periods of time moving around an office environment and the campus. The person in this role must be able to perform the essential functions with or without an accommodation.
